And here’s how to build a shoe cubby! Step 1: Cut & polish. First download the full build plan here. After cutting, I polished any rough edges with fine-grit sandpaper. Step 2: Attach the sides to the top. Step 3: Drill pocket holes for shelves. Step 4: Attach the shelves. Step 5: Nail dividers into ... See more First download the full build plan here. After cutting, I polished any rough edges with fine-grit sandpaper. See more I propped mine sides up and set the top on to get a better idea of what I was working with. Here’s a right-side up view and an upside down view: I made a small mark on the inside of the sides to indicate where I needed to drill … See more I flipped the assembled piece upside down and attached each shelf by drilling through the pocket holes directly into the sides. To get the spacing just right, I set two divider pieces (that I cut in step 1) in place to hold the shelf up while … See more Next I drilled pocket holes on the sides of each of the three shelves. The pocket holes were drilled on the bottom of each shelf so you wouldn’t be able to see them when I put everything together. See more WebPlus, there are plans to build the shoe cubby yourself. WebSep 25, 2024 · 12 Practical and Stylish Shoe Cubby Ideas to Show off Your Footwear. 1. Colorful Shoe Pods. For an artistic looking shoe storage cubby, grab some wood and make different shapes out of them. You can also make polygons and stack each pod up. Color them for an eye-popping design.
